NBA 2020-21 Regular Season Structure

For the 2020-21 season, there will be 72 games for each team. In the first half of the season, the teams will have an All-Star break for 5 days on March 5, 2020. And, the second half of the season will begin on March 11, 2020, and will finish on May 16, 2020.

At the same time, the regular season will have each team within each division play three games against an intraconference opponent (42 games per team). Also, the league’s office has assigned each team with an opponent they will be playing either once at home or once on the road.

When the regular season concludes, playoffs will begin on May 22nd and finish on July 22nd.

Although the schedule above has been released; it could change due to the pandemic. Of course, the schedule is to keep all players and personnel safe.

Since there are some trades in the works and other free agents who are still available; there may be some changes before the season officially opens.
